I read one stat that said 60% of bipolar patients will have at least one instance of substance abuse at some point and 30% are abusing at least one substance at any given time. I suspect it is even worse for the undiagnosed/untreated. My last drug of choice was adderall and also alcohol. I would have preferred weed but I steer clear of illegal (and it is where I am) drugs now. My pdoc tells me my "way back in the day" illegal drug use was self medicating and I preferred euphorics and psychedelics.
I spend a lot more time depressed than manic (or in my case, hypomanic), so a euphoric to make me feel better or speed (which is what adderall and meth are) to kick me into my own euphoria are what appeal to me. Anyway, I suspect the answer to your question is depression, whether it is unipolar or bipolar.
